The Architectural and Site Review Board (ASRB) of Woodside, California, holds regular meetings to discuss and review local development projects and site planning applications. These public sessions are essential for maintaining the town's architectural standards and community character. Residents and stakeholders are encouraged to attend to stay informed about upcoming projects and provide input on matters affecting the local landscape. Agendas are typically available prior to the meeting for public review.

Frequently Asked Questions
When does the ASRB meet?
The board meets on the 1st and 3rd Monday of every month.
Where is the meeting held?
Meetings are held at Independence Hall, 2955 Woodside Road, Woodside, CA.
Are agendas available?
Yes, agendas are published prior to the meeting on the town website.
Is the meeting open to the public?
Yes, these are public meetings.
What time does it start?
The meeting begins at 4:30 PM.
Can I provide input?
Yes, public participation is encouraged during designated agenda items.
